About 1 Norwich Court

A plain-English summary derived from public records, EPC certificates, sold prices and local data.

1 Norwich Court is an end-of-terrace house in Ipswich (IP1 2PA). It has a recorded floor area of 42 m² (around 452 sq ft), construction records dating it to 1950-1966 and council tax band A. The latest certificate (January 2019) shows a D (score 62), on the cusp of jumping into the C band. When first surveyed in November 2008 the rating was E, the property has climbed 1 band since. Between certificates, wall efficiency went from Poor to Good, lighting went from Very Poor to Very Good and main heating went from Poor to Average; while window efficiency dropped from Good to Average. The recommended improvements would push it to C (score 77). Main heating runs on electricity. At 42 m² this is the 3rd smallest of 5 units on EPC record in 1 Norwich Court, where floor areas span 31–49 m². The building's EPC ratings span E to C across 5 units on file.

It hasn't traded since October 1998, a hold of 28 years that's notably long for the area. Only one transfer is on record with HM Land Registry, suggesting it has stayed in the same hands for a long time. Today's modelled estimate of £112,000 sits 700% above the 1998 sale of £14,000. On a £-per-square-foot basis, the last sale (£31/sq ft) was about 72.9% below the postcode norm. At 42 m² it's 16.7% larger than the typical home in the postcode (36 m² median across 42 EPCs).
